Overview

Methyl nadic anhydride ( CAS 25134-21-8 ), also known as nadic methyl anhydride or MNA, is a cycloaliphatic anhydride used as a curing agent and reactive intermediate in high-performance polymer systems.

It delivers thermally stable, chemically resistant cured networks suited to demanding structural and electrical applications. In epoxy resin formulations for aerospace and automotive composites, MNA produces cured systems.

These systems feature high glass transition temperatures and long pot life, which are critical for large-part processing. Electronics manufacturers use it to encapsulate and pot components where dimensional stability is required.

In electrical laminates and printed circuit board resins, MNA contributes to low dielectric loss and resistance to moisture uptake. Adhesive and sealant formulators incorporate it into systems requiring flexibility.

This is particularly useful where cycloaliphatic chemistry improves UV stability over aromatic alternatives. Methyl nadic anhydride is supplied as a low-viscosity liquid, facilitating direct blending with liquid epoxy systems.

It is available in technical and industrial grades, with purity levels typically specified at 95% or higher. Standard packaging ranges from drums to intermediate bulk containers for high-volume compounders.

Physical Properties

Boiling Point140°C (10 mmHg)
Density1.200-1.250 g/cm³ @ Temp: 20 °C
Flash Point>230 °F
Appearanceclear light yellow oily liquid
ColorClear light yellow
FormOily Liquid
Water SolubilityREACTS
Vapor Pressure5 mm Hg ( 120 °C)
Refractive Indexn 20/D 1.506(lit.)
Log P-4.01 at 20℃

Other Names

Methylbicyclo[2.2.1]hept-5-ene-23-dicarboxylic anhydride | Methyl himic anhydride | Nadic methyl anhydride | Kayahard MCD | Epicure NMA | Methendic anhydride | Hardener HY906 | Methylendic anhydride | MNA
